摘要
Suburban areas, historically associated with homogeneity, low-density and poor public transport services, have experienced a process of "maturation" and diversification over the past two decades. The rise of new configurations has recently contributed to restructure travel-patterns and accessibility in these areas. This paper aims at analyzing the inequalities in accessibility to urban amenities in the suburban areas of Lille, a metropolitan area with a diversified socioeconomic profile and multipolar spatial configuration. Findings demonstrate that the multipolarity of the metropolitan area configures fairly high levels of accessibility for suburban inhabitants, except for low density areas in the southern districts. Furthermore, results emphasize that, although inequalities in accessibility are not as prominent at a residential level, privileged groups seem to benefit from a significant accessibility gain at a non- residential level.
